Fayette County Man Faces Charges Threatening His Wife at Gunpoint

A man in Fayette County faces several charges after deputies said he pulled his wife from a vehicle at gunpoint and then choked her until she passed out. Matthew Coleman of Jodie was charged after an incident that occurred Thursday. The Fayette County Sheriff’s Office said deputies began an investigation after learning about a domestic incident that occurred on U.S. 60 in the Hawks Nest State Park area. The woman reported she was driving on the road when her husband blocked her in with his vehicle and then pulled her from her vehicle at gunpoint, struck her and choked her until she passed out. She was eventually able to reach a neighbor for help after reaching home. Coleman is facing several charges.
